Description:

Performs activities in the radio studio and control room to ensure technical quality of sound for programs originating in the studio from syndications or from remote pickup points. Responsibilities:

Regulates timing of programs, operates syndicated programming and plays commercials. Off-air support of commercial production, dubbing music to hard disk and programming automation computers. Monitors and updates weather, traffic, and news reports into automation equipment. Performs on-air announcements or shifts as assigned. Assist with remote appearances Takes transmitter readings and maintains transmitter logs.  Other duties to be assigned

Requirements:

High school diploma or general education degree (GED); six months experience and/or training; or equivalent combination of education and experience. Special Job Requirements: Responsible for on-air elements.  Knowledge of NexGen Audio Control System, phone screener software, audio boards, audio recording equipment, ISDN, and TELCO systems and remote transmitter monitoring equipment is a plus. Candidate must be available to work nights, weekends and holidays.
